Step 1: Use the Pythagorean Theorem to find the height, h:
r^2 + h^2 = s^2
5^2 + h^2 = 13^2
25 + h^2 = 169
h^2 = 144
h = 12
Step 2: Calculate the volume using the formula V = (1/3) * π * r^2 * h:
V = (1/3) * π * 5^2 * 12
V = (1/3) * π * 25 * 12
V = (1/3) * π * 300
V = 100π
V ≈ 314.2 cm^3
